W A withdrawal from a class (W) is GPA-neutral: instead of a grade, you receive a W notation on your transcript which does not affect your GPA; you also don't earn credits for the course.

You can make this request regardless of the grading option you chose at the time of enrollment; however, you must be in good academic standing to request a No Pass grade. If a drop is submitted in MyUCSC after the add/drop/swap deadline and by the end of the sixth week of instruction (see the Academic and Administrative Calendar for deadlines), the course appears on your record with a “W” notation. After the sixth week of instruction and until the deadline listed in the Academic and Administrative Calendar, students in good academic standing may use the same process to withdraw from a course by requesting a “NP” (No Pass) notation. "Withdrawing from a class," whether with a W or NP, means you stop participating in the class before the end of the quarter - you may not withdraw from a class if you've completed the final course work or final exam. You cannot use this form to petition for all W or all NP grades in any regular quarter; if you are not able to complete any courses, use the Petition for Withdrawal/ Leave of Absence to withdraw from the entire quarter. You may withdraw from a class with a “W” notation after the sixth week deadline for documented medical or emergency reasons - contact an advisor at your college if this is the case.

Read More »Requesting a W or NP does not affect financial aid for the current quarter, as long as you remain enrolled in and are attending/participating in some of your courses. However, it can affect your future financial aid if you do not maintain satisfactory academic progress. Keep in mind that if you withdraw or NP, you are not earning credits for the class and will likely need to make them up later. Financial Aid requires students to meet Satisfactory Academic Progress requirements to remain eligible for aid. If you are following a detailed plan for a financial aid appeal, please consult with a financial aid advisor as this may affect your ability to continue receiving aid. We recommend that you take these options seriously, and use them only when absolutely necessary. Many graduate schools may look unfavorably on a pattern of W or NP grades.
